Formatge Mallorquí and Olive Tapenade Recipe

Ingredients with Measurements:
- 1/2 pound of Formatge Mallorquí cheese
- 1 cup of pitted Kalamata olives
- 1/4 cup of extra-virgin olive oil
- 2 cloves of gar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on of capers
- 1 tablespoon of lemon juice
- 1/4 teaspoon of black pepper
- 1/4 teaspoon of red pepper flakes
- 1 tablespoon of fresh parsley, chopped

Special equipment needed:
- Food processor or blender

Step-by-step instructions:

1. Cut the Formatge Mallorquí cheese into small cubes and set aside.
2. In a food processor or blender, combine the pitted Kalamata olives, extra-virgin olive oil, minced garlic, capers, lemon juice, black pepper, and red pepper flakes. Pulse until the mixture is smooth.
3. Transfer the olive tapenade to a serving bowl and stir in the chopped parsley.
4. Arrange the Formatge Mallorquí cheese cubes on a platter or serving dish.
5. Serve the olive tapenade alongside the cheese cubes for dipping.

Substitutions for ingredients:
- Formatge Mallorquí cheese can be substituted with any semi-hard cheese such as cheddar or gouda.
- Kalamata olives can be substituted with any other type of pitted olive.
- Capers can be omitted if desired.

Variations:
- Add roasted red peppers or sun-dried tomatoes to the olive tapenade for extra flavor.
- Use different herbs such as basil or oregano instead of parsley.

Tips and tricks:
- For a smoother texture, blend the olive tapenade for longer in the food processor or blender.
- Serve the cheese and olive tapenade at room temperature for the best flavor.

Storage instructions:
- Store any leftover olive tapenade in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 1 week.
